Research Goal Creating shapes in a three dimensional environment is a complex operation which often requires the adoption of very constrained techniques. The shape modelling phase plays a fundamental role within the design process because it allows the improvement of the visual appeal of artefacts. It also enhances ergonomics and the product’s commercial competitiveness through product differentiation. Natural and intuitive, yet mathematically correct, creation and modification of surfaces is a fundamental requirement when flexibility and intuition have to be privileged to unleash the designer’s creativity during the concept design phase. Efficient and intuitive shape manipulation techniques are therefore vital to the success of geometric modelling, computer animation, physical simulation and other computing areas. The goal of the research is to define and support different forms of constraint-based design. In this context “constraints” are design features, preliminary defined by an operator, which should be properly integrated with the final CAD product. The activities include:
This will be done within a software framework for interactive Virtual Reality-based applications. The framework allows the definition of design applications capable of providing multimodal user interfaces combining sketches, gestures and speech among others.
